The quick way:
::
pip install pyodps[full]
If you don’t need to use Jupyter, just type
::
pip install pyodps
The dependencies will be installed automatically.
Or from source code (not recommended for production use):
.. code:: shell
$ virtualenv pyodps_env $ source pyodps_env/bin/activate $ pip install git+https://github.com/aliyun/aliyun-odps-python-sdk.git

.. code:: python
import os from odps import ODPS
Make sure environment variable CLOUD_ACCESS_KEY_ID already set to Access Key ID of user
while environment variable CLOUD_ACCESS_KEY_SECRET set to Access Key Secret of user.
Not recommended to hardcode Access Key ID or Access Key Secret in your code.
o = ODPS( os.getenv('CLOUD_ACCESS_KEY_ID'), os.getenv('CLOUD_ACCESS_KEY_SECRET'), project='your-project', endpoint='your-endpoint', ) dual = o.get_table('dual') dual.name 'dual' dual.table_schema odps.Schema { c_int_a bigint c_int_b bigint c_double_a double c_double_b double c_string_a string c_string_b string c_bool_a boolean c_bool_b boolean c_datetime_a datetime c_datetime_b datetime } dual.creation_time datetime.datetime(2014, 6, 6, 13, 28, 24) dual.is_virtual_view False dual.size 448 dual.table_schema.columns [<column c_int_a, type bigint>, <column c_int_b, type bigint>, <column c_double_a, type double>, <column c_double_b, type double>, <column c_string_a, type string>, <column c_string_b, type string>, <column c_bool_a, type boolean>, <column c_bool_b, type boolean>, <column c_datetime_a, type datetime>, <column c_datetime_b, type datetime>]

.. code:: python
#file: plus.py from odps.udf import annotate
@annotate('bigint,bigint->bigint') class Plus(object): def evaluate(self, a, b): return a + b
::
$ cat plus.input 1,1 3,2 $ pyou plus.Plus < plus.input 2 5
For a development install, clone the repository and then install from source:
::
git clone https://github.com/aliyun/aliyun-odps-python-sdk.git cd pyodps pip install -r requirements.txt -e .
